COLLEGE BASEBALL: No. 13 FSU Faces No. 7 UF in Rubber Game

TALLAHASSEE, Fla. – No. 13 Florida State (26-12) returns home after a tough weekend series in South Bend, Ind., to face No. 7 Florida (28-9) on Tuesday in the rubber game between these two intra-state rivals. First pitch for the third and final game of the ‘Share A Little Sunshine Showdown’ regular season series is set for 6:00 p.m. and will air live on ESPN3.

The Gators defeated the Seminoles 14-8 in Gainesville in the first match-up this year, before FSU evened the series with an 8-3 victory at the Baseball Grounds in Jacksonville.

In the first meeting in Gainesville, the Gators outhit the Seminoles 16-9, while FSU tied a season-high committing five errors. The 14 runs by Florida were the most scored by the Gators in the series since plating 16 against the Seminoles in Jacksonville on April 3, 2007. It also marked the most combined runs by the two teams since a 17-11 victory by Florida State in an NCAA Regional elimination game on May 31, 2008.

In Jacksonville on March 31, the Seminoles got 5.0 strong innings from Bryant Holtmann, while Dylan Silva worked the final 4.0 innings to earn the save. FSU outhit UF 13-6 on the night led by John Sansone’s career-high 4-for-4 performance at the plate.

Holtmann will make his second straight start against the Gators on Tuesday night. In seven career appearances, six in relief against UF, Holtmann is 1-0 with a 2.03 ERA. He has allowed three runs, 13 hits, four walks and 10 strikeouts in 13.1 innings. The senior southpaw is 1-0 with a 2.35 ERA in 7.2 innings against the Gators in 2015.
